Gambling Control Board hears industry update, approves routine transfers and licensing items

The Gambling Control Board met in Roseville and on the record received an industry and budget update from Director Wade, heard a report from the Compliance Review Group, and approved a series of routine exhibits including transfers of gambling funds, property and capital expenditures, contributions between licensed organizations, a fund-loss request and license termination plans.
Director Wade said March total gross receipts for charitable gambling were $432,000,000, a 4.6% decline from the previous year, and that electronic pull-tab receipts for March were down about 16% while paper pull-tab receipts were up about 10%. He said April electronic pull-tab receipts were down 13.9%.
“The year to date gross receipts for FY '25, which is the 9 month period from July 2024 through March 2025, totaled 3,670,000,000.00, which is almost identical to last year's gross receipts for that same time period,” Wade said. He also told the board the drop in electronic pull-tab receipts through March was largely offset by a 2.6% increase in paper pull-tab receipts.
